Output 21ec616cd7bb0d2233bbb3c0db94f83d0ce0033ee8c53fab1bca3d6f4b85e153: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7062538f4d217c065583ac2e62d7109d17477d79 OP_EQUAL
address
3BwFPsFRuQU6EjxgJYQ3KkU5RgNpGYq2vt
transaction
21ec616cd7bb0d2233bbb3c0db94f83d0ce0033ee8c53fab1bca3d6f4b85e153
spent
true